🏞️ Trek Overview

  1. Distance: 55–60 km round trip

  2. Duration: 6–7 days

  3. Roopkund Trek Difficulty: Moderate

  4. Best Time: May–June & September–October for clear views and pleasant weather

Highlights of the Trek

  1. Ali Bedni Bugyal: A lush green meadow at 3,354 m, perfect for camping and sunrise views.

  2. Roopkund Lake (Roopkund Jheel): Famous for skeletal remains and surrounded by dramatic peaks.

  3. Scenic Villages: Cross quaint Uttarakhand villages offering authentic local culture.

  4. Camping Experience: Set up tents amidst alpine meadows and starry nights.

Detailed Itinerary

DayRouteHighlights
1Dehradun/Rishikesh → LohajungBase camp preparation
2 Lohajung → Bedni BugyalForest walk, alpine meadows
3 Bedni Bugyal → Roopkund LakeSummit view, photography
4Roopkund → Bedni BugyalReturn trek, sunset views
5Bedni Bugyal → LohajungTrek end, local villages
6Lohajung → Dehradun/RishikeshDeparture

🌄 Key Tips

  1. Carry layered clothing for changing weather.

  2. Best to start early for Roopkund summit to avoid afternoon clouds.

  3. Stay hydrated and follow Leave No Trace principles.
